Trader Joe’s confirms plans to open new location in Merriam

Trader Joe’s is officially opening a grocery store in Merriam. For the first time last week in a press release, the California-based grocery store confirmed plans to open a new location at Merriam Grand Station Marketplace. Status Nightclub closed by city officials after deadly shooting inside the club

Signs posted today on front and side doors of the Status nightclub in Kansas City, Missouri, state the club is closed "because it has been deemed unsafe by the building official."

Crews respond to apartment ceiling collapse in Shawnee, 3 people displaced

The Shawnee Fire Department and Johnson County MED-ACT responded to a reported structure collapse around 9:10 a.m. Thursday in Shawnee, Kansas.
